本文主要探讨了二道江apk麻将开发的资深技术及经验分享。在这篇文章中,我们将从设计、开发、优化、测试和发布等多个方面详细介绍二道江apk麻将的制作流程和技术要点。我们希望读者可以通过本文的阅读,了解并掌握二道江apk麻将开发的基础知识和技术要领,为自己在这个领域的发展提供参考。
1. 设计阶段
在设计阶段,我们需要考虑到麻将的目标用户群体,以及用户的需求和喜好等因素。更具体的,要设计出简单易用、界面友好、功能实用的麻将,需要经过用户需求调研、界面设计、功能设计等多个方面的工作才能实现。
2. 开发阶段
在开发阶段,需要选择合适的编程语言和开发工具,以及开发平台,比如安卓或IOS等。然后需要编写程序代码、调试程序、测试功能等,确保麻将程序的流畅运行和各项功能的正常使用。
3. 优化阶段
优化阶段是为了确保麻将的运行速度、资源占用等方面更为优化。在这个阶段,我们需要针对麻将界面、功能、性能等方面进行优化,以确保麻将在用户使用时能够顺畅执行,而不会卡顿和出现错误等问题。
4. 测试阶段
测试阶段是麻将开发的最后一个重要环节。在这个阶段,需要对麻将程序进行全面的测试,包括功能测试、界面测试、性能测试和安全测试等多个方面的测试。通过全面的测试来确保麻将的质量和稳定性,以及确保麻将的可靠性和安全性。
5. 发布阶段
在发布阶段,需要将麻将提交到各个应用程序商店,如苹果应用商店、谷歌应用商店等。在发布过程中,需要注意麻将的版本信息、功能说明、用户反馈等方面的问题,以确保麻将的质量和关注度。
通过上述五个方面的阶段,我们可以完成二道江apk麻将的设计、开发、优化、测试和发布等多个环节的工作,从而实现一个高质量的应用程序。如果您有兴趣进一步了解二道江apk麻将开发的技术要领和经验分享,请参考我们的其他文章和专业资料。
本文将探讨二道江apk麻将开发的资深技术及经验分享。在本文中,我们将介绍二道江apk麻将开发的基本知识,包括如何编写代码、设计用户界面、测试和发布应用程序等方面。我们还将分享我们在开发这种应用程序时遇到的一些问题及如何解决这些问题的经验。
1. 二道江apk麻将开发的基础知识
二道江apk麻将是基于Android操作系统开发的应用程序。与其他应用程序开发相比,其中最重要的知识是Java编程语言。开发者需要具备Java编写代码的能力,以实现应用程序的各种功能。
此外,为了制作出优秀的二道江apk麻将,开发者需要掌握以下方面的知识:
(1)Android SDK和API:Android SDK是开发Android应用程序所必须的麻将开发工具包,它包含Android平台中所需的所有API、文档和示例代码等。API指的是应用程序接口,它提供了Android平台上操作系统和应用程序之间的通信方式。
(2)用户界面设计:良好的用户界面设计是二道江apk麻将开发的一个重要方面。一个好的用户界面能够让用户更好地使用应用程序,提高用户体验。
2. 编写代码
编写代码是二道江apk麻将开发中最基本的任务。在编写代码的过程中,开发者应该考虑具体的应用场景,编写出易于理解和扩展的代码。
同时,在编写代码过程中,开发者还应该注意以下事项:
(1)模块化编程:代码应该按照模块进行编写,每个模块处理独立的任务,并且功能相对独立。
(2)遵循编码规范:遵循编码规范能够确保代码的可读性和可维护性。
(3)注释:注释能够让其他开发者更好地理解你的代码,并且更好地维护代码。
3. 用户界面设计
良好的用户界面是二道江apk麻将开发的关键。良好的用户界面能够让用户更愿意使用应用程序,提高用户体验。
在设计用户界面时,开发者应该遵循以下原则:
(1)简洁易懂:用户界面应该是简洁易懂的,以尽可能减少用户的认知负担。
(2)交互性:用户界面应该具有良好的交互性,以便用户完成想要的操作。
(3)符合设计原则:用户界面应该符合设计原则,如颜色、布局、字体等。
4. 测试和发布
测试和发布是二道江apk麻将开发的关键环节。在发布应用程序之前,开发者需要进行麻将测试,以确保应用程序的质量。
在测试应用程序时,开发者应该注意以下事项:
(1)测试用例的编写:开发者需要编写详细的测试用例,以确定应用程序能够在不同的情况下都能正常工作。
(2)Bug的修复:当发现应用程序存在缺陷时,及时修复缺陷,以确保应用程序的健康运行。
(3)发布应用程序:发布应用程序时,需要注意应用程序的安全性、稳定性和兼容性。
5. 解决问题的经验
在开发二道江apk麻将时,开发者难免会遇到各种不同的问题。以下是我们在开发过程中遇到的一些问题及解决方法:
(1)内存泄漏问题:内存泄漏会导致应用程序在运行时崩溃,解决方法是使用Android的内存管理机制,确保内存得到正确释放。
(2)卡顿问题:卡顿会导致用户体验差,解决方法是优化代码,尽量使用异步操作,避免UI主线程卡死。
(3)多屏幕适配问题:不同的手机分辨率和屏幕尺寸不同,解决方法是使用不同的布局文件、使用dp管理尺寸等。
本文详细介绍了二道江apk麻将开发的基础知识、编写代码、用户界面设计、测试和发布、解决问题的经验。希望这些经验分享能够帮助更多的开发者掌握这项技术,开发出更加优秀的应用程序。